Core Principles of Steve Burns’s Trading Philosophy 1. Focus on Trends Burns advocates for trend-following strategies, believing that identifying and riding existing market trends provides the best opportunities for profit. He emphasizes that markets tend to move in identifiable directions over sustained periods, and catching these trends early can lead to significant gains. 2 2. Simple and Clear Strategies One of Burns’s key teachings is the importance of simplicity in trading systems. He recommends using straightforward technical indicators like moving averages, trendlines, and price action analysis rather than overly complex setups. This approach reduces confusion and helps traders stay disciplined. 3. Risk Management and Position Sizing Burns stresses that protecting capital is paramount. He advocates for setting stop-loss orders, managing risk per trade, and avoiding over-leverage. Proper position sizing ensures traders can withstand losing streaks without devastating their accounts. 4. Patience and Discipline Success in trading requires patience to wait for ideal setups and discipline to follow trading plans consistently. Burns encourages traders to develop mental toughness and avoid impulsive decisions driven by emotions. Key Trading Strategies Promoted by Steve Burns Trend Following with Moving Averages Burns often recommends using simple moving averages (SMAs) as trend indicators. For example: - The 20-day and 50-day SMAs can help identify the trend direction. - A buy signal occurs when the shorter-term moving average crosses above the longer-term average. - A sell signal is generated when the shorter-term average crosses below. Breakout and Pullback Trading This involves: - Watching for price breakouts above resistance or below support levels. - Confirming breakouts with volume and other indicators. - Using pullbacks to enter trades at better prices once the initial breakout has occurred. Swing Trading Approach Burns advocates for swing trading, holding positions from a few days to several weeks, capitalizing on intermediate price swings within the overall trend. Today, Steve Burns is regarded as a leading voice in trading education, particularly among retail traders seeking a structured and disciplined approach to the markets. --- The Trading Philosophy of Steve Burns Core Principles At the heart of Steve Burns’ approach are several foundational principles: - Discipline Over Emotion: Recognizing that emotional trading often leads to losses, Burns advocates for strict discipline and predetermined rules. - Risk Management: Protecting capital is paramount. He emphasizes setting stop-loss orders and managing position sizes to avoid catastrophic losses. - Trend Following: Burns is a proponent of following market trends rather than trying to predict reversals prematurely. - Simplicity: Complex strategies are often less effective. Burns promotes straightforward techniques based on clear signals. The "Cut Losses Short and Let Profits Run" Ethos A central tenet of Burns’ strategy is the importance of capital preservation. He advises traders to cut losses quickly and allow winners to grow, fostering a mindset of patience and resilience. The Role of Technical Analysis Burns relies heavily on technical analysis tools, such as moving averages, chart patterns, and momentum indicators, to identify high-probability setups. He believes that understanding market behavior through technical signals is more reliable than trying to predict news-driven moves. --- Key Strategies and Techniques Moving Averages and Trend Indicators Burns often uses simple moving averages (SMAs), like the 50-day and 200-day, to identify trend directions. When the shorter-term SMA crosses above the longer-term SMA, it signals a potential uptrend; the opposite indicates a downtrend. Chart Patterns He emphasizes recognizing classic chart patterns such as: - Head and Shoulders - Double Tops and Bottoms - Triangles and Flags These patterns suggest potential trend continuations or reversals, helping traders make informed decisions. Momentum and Volume Combining price action with volume analysis helps confirm the strength of a move. Burns advocates entering trades when momentum aligns with trend signals, minimizing false signals. Trading Discipline Burns recommends maintaining a trading journal, following a strict trading plan, and avoiding impulsive decisions.
